Output 39bf77e52f37ba79bc2d6988e38109021a5b03e8011a99d57810db70f691467e:0

value
3749000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57c95a2fb43c9c894e3f68b72e907088a37a03d8 OP_EQUAL
address
39hBvSCwuCrrwp8EFt1Djow8NPW62DCeab
transaction
39bf77e52f37ba79bc2d6988e38109021a5b03e8011a99d57810db70f691467e
confirmations
136222
spent
true